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Hackney Central to Penmere start from as little as £39.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Hackney Central to Penmere start from £146.70 one way, or £147.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Hackney Central to Penmere are available for £169.50 one way, or £339.00 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Hackney Central is well-equipped to meet the needs of its passengers. Ticket machines are available and accessible, and you can effortlessly collect tickets purchased online at these machines. While smartcards aren't issued here, you'll still find it easy to navigate your way around. The station is also designed with accessibility in mind. Partial step-free access is available, with specific provisions such as wheelchair-accessible ticket machines, ramps for train access, and customer help points to assist travelers with any queries or special needs. Although there are no accessible toilets or luggage storage, the station ensures safety with the presence of CCTV.

Although Hackney Central lacks refreshment facilities and shopping options within the station, the neighboring area is rich with cafes, restaurants, and local shops eager to serve up a taste of East London's unique flair. And if you're ever in need of some help, the staff are available at the ticket office and through the help point for assistance. However, for those looking for a bit of down-time before their next train, note that there is no seating area or first-class lounge but waiting rooms are open for use during the station's operating times.

Onward Travel Options

Continuing your journey from Hackney Central is a breeze thanks to its excellent transport connections. For eastbound services to Stratford, head to Bus Stop T on Amhurst Road. Westbound travelers aiming for Camden Road can catch services from Bus Stop K on the same street. While there are no dedicated taxi ranks immediately accessible, various private hire options can be easily arranged via phone or app-based services. Cyclists are also welcomed, with 16 bicycle spaces available, though these are not sheltered.

Facilities and Accessibility at Penmere Station

Penmere Train Station, though lacking a ticket office, provides ticket machines for easy passage onto local services. However, you'll need to purchase tickets in advance, as it does not have facilities for collecting tickets bought online. For those requiring assistance, there is a help point, ensuring all passengers receive the help they need for a smooth journey. Accessibility is a prominent feature at Penmere, with step-free access to parts of the station and a ramp enabling ease of movement from the car park to the platform. Despite the limitations in terms of modern amenities like Wi-Fi, the station offers functional essentials including a cozy seating area and the vital ramp for train access to accommodate passengers with mobility constraints.
